In all its 31-year history, it housed 336 seminarians of which 185 received the ordination at the priesthood. Currently, in our community, the Grand Séminaire keeps playing an important role at the service level, for example: the involvement of retired priests living there and celebrating the mass at the Sisters of the Assumption’s house and in several parishes. In this chapel, a Casavant organ dating from 1952 can be found with the opus number 2138, installed during the construction. It is a typical “unified organ”. It performs well to accompany the liturgy, but is not complete enough for the presentation of solo concerts. Photo credit: Répertoire des orgues du Québec. (2016). Grand séminaire de Nicolet [Image].
